There are no absolute requirements, but I do recommend having a tablet (a product like Wacom or Huion, for example) as well as a digital painting application.


For traditional media, any brand of watercolors and gouache will work, though do not recommend student-grade paints. I use brands like Winsor&Newton, Holbein, and Daniel Smith. I also recommend using at least 140lb paper, as anything thinner will not be able to survive multiple washes.

Meet Marco!

Marco Bucci

Illustrator | Educator

Marco Bucci recognized two things at a young age. The first was that he wanted to become a professional artist. The second was that he couldn't draw. This delayed him for quite some time. He filled that time pursuing other artistic interests such as music and writing, but the urge to draw never left him. At age 19 he began to study classical drawing, which led him to kindle a love for painting and illustration. He hasn't looked back since. ​Marco's experience includes books, film, animation, and advertising. His clients include: Walt Disney Publishing Worldwide, LEGO, LucasArts, Mattel Toys, Fisher-Price, Hasbro, Nelvana, GURU Studio, C.O.R.E. Digital Pictures, Yowza! Animation Inc., Pipeline Studios, and more.
